Split Testing vs. Multivariate Testing

A/B Testing (Split Testing) Multivariate Testing (MVT)
What it tests One variable at a time Multiple variables simultaneously
What you learn Exactly what caused the result Which combination performs best
Traffic required 1,000-5,000 users per variant 50,000+ visitors per page
Best for Most SaaS teams and use cases High-traffic pages like the homepage or pricing
Risk Low. Clean, causal data High. Underpowered tests produce noise
When to use Always start here Only once you have the traffic to support it

Why Traditional A/B Testing Approaches Break in SaaS?

Most SaaS teams don't have a testing problem. They have a process problem. Here's what actually happens at most companies: the growth team launches an experiment because someone had an idea, not because they had a hypothesis. They run it for five days, see a 3% lift, call it significant, and ship.

1. Running Tests Without Statistical Significance

The standard threshold for a valid A/B test is 95% statistical confidence (p-value below 0.05). Most teams don't hit it because they stop tests too early. You see an early positive trend, you get excited, you stop the test. This is called "peeking," and it's responsible for a huge percentage of false positives in SaaS A/B testing.

2. Measuring the Wrong Metric

A SaaS company runs an A/B test on its pricing page CTA. Version B wins with a 22% higher click rate. They ship it. Paid conversions stay flat. Why? Because click rate on a pricing CTA doesn't equal revenue. If you're not measuring the metric that actually matters, you're optimizing for the wrong thing.

3. Testing Too Many Things at Once

Your engineering team is shipping new features. Your marketing team is running email campaigns. Your designer updated the UI. Any of those changes can contaminate results. Concurrent experiments need to be coordinated so you know what caused what.

Common A/B Testing Scenarios in SaaS

1. Onboarding Flow Optimization

Onboarding is the most important test surface in SaaS. It determines whether a user reaches their first value moment. The job of onboarding A/B testing is to reduce the distance between "just signed up" and "I get why this product exists."

4. Churn Reduction and Cancel Flow Testing

Your cancel flow is a conversion page. When a user initiates cancellation, they're already in motion, but they haven't left yet.

Industry Research: Paddle (ProfitWell)

Paddle analyzed cancellation data across 23,000+ subscription businesses. Their benchmarks show companies with A/B-tested cancel flows reduce voluntary monthly churn by an average of 17%.

Best Practices for SaaS A/B Testing

# Best Practice Why It Matters
1 Define your success metric before launch Lock in one primary metric tied to a business outcome before you see a single data point.
2 Calculate the sample size before you start Most SaaS A/B tests need 1,000–5,000 unique users per variant.
3 Test one variable at a time One change per test. Clean causality is the point.
4 Measure downstream SaaS metrics, not just clicks Track activation and retention, not just immediate conversion points.
5 Segment your results after the test Did certain segments respond differently?
6 Protect power users from experiment fatigue Cap experiment exposure per user cohort.
7 Document every test, wins and losses both Compounding advantage comes from institutional knowledge.
8 Match test priority to your growth stage Test onboarding first when you are early-stage.

Frequently Asked Questions

What is the minimum sample size for a statistically valid SaaS A/B test? For most SaaS A/B tests, you need a minimum of 1,000 to 5,000 unique users per variant to reach statistical significance.

How long should I run an A/B test for a SaaS product? Run every A/B test for a minimum of two full weeks regardless of early results.

What metrics should SaaS companies track in A/B tests? Define your primary success metric before launching the test, tied to a business outcome like 30-day activation rate.

How is A/B testing different for SaaS versus eCommerce? In SaaS, you're optimizing a lifecycle that spans onboarding, activation, retention, and expansion.
